NEW TRIAL SOUGHT

LIABILITY IN MOTOR ACCIDENT.

(By Telegraph—Press Association.) WELLINGTON, Aug. 4. Counsel for Leonard Mervyn Wallace, against whom the jury awarded £507 as the result of it collision on the Hutt road and the claim of Arthur H.irscliorn for damages, lias applied to the Supreme Court for a non-suit, a new trial or a verdict for defendant. The ease hinged upon liability for failing to signal ail intention to turn. Hirseiiorn. a motor cyclist, was severely injured when he struck Wallace’s ear. Mr Justice Reed reserved ihis decision.
